In 1910 he wrote the words and music for an unsuccessful song he called “Danny Boy”. The author of the famous lyrics Oh Danny Boy, the pipes, the pipes are calling was an English lawyer, Frederic Edward Weatherly (1848–1929), who was also a songwriter and radio entertainer.
